|
Material Accounting Policies - Summary of Estimated Useful Lives For Current and Comparative Period (Detail)
|12 Months Ended
Dec. 31, 2023
|Machinery and equipment [Member]
|Disclosure of detailed information about property, plant and equipment [Line Items]
|Useful life (years)
|10
|Annual depreciation rate
|10.00%
|Office furniture and equipment [Member]
|Disclosure of detailed information about property, plant and equipment [Line Items]
|Useful life (years)
|10
|Annual depreciation rate
|10.00%
|Computer equipment [Member] | Bottom of Range [Member]
|Disclosure of detailed information about property, plant and equipment [Line Items]
|Useful life (years)
|3.3
|Annual depreciation rate
|25.00%
|Computer equipment [Member] | Top of Range [Member]
|Disclosure of detailed information about property, plant and equipment [Line Items]
|Useful life (years)
|4
|Annual depreciation rate
|30.00%
|Transportation equipment [Member] | Bottom of Range [Member]
|Disclosure of detailed information about property, plant and equipment [Line Items]
|Useful life (years)
|4
|Annual depreciation rate
|20.00%
|Transportation equipment [Member] | Top of Range [Member]
|Disclosure of detailed information about property, plant and equipment [Line Items]
|Useful life (years)
|5
|Annual depreciation rate
|25.00%
|Communication equipment [Member] | Bottom of Range [Member]
|Disclosure of detailed information about property, plant and equipment [Line Items]
|Useful life (years)
|3.3
|Annual depreciation rate
|10.00%
|Communication equipment [Member] | Top of Range [Member]
|Disclosure of detailed information about property, plant and equipment [Line Items]
|Useful life (years)
|10
|Annual depreciation rate
|30.00%
|Communication equipment [Member] | Middle Range [Member]
|Disclosure of detailed information about property, plant and equipment [Line Items]
|Useful life (years)
|4
|Annual depreciation rate
|25.00%
|Improvements on leased assets [Member]
|Disclosure of detailed information about property, plant and equipment [Line Items]
|Useful life (years)
|10
|Annual depreciation rate
|10.00%
|X
- Definition
+ References
Line items represent concepts included in a table. These concepts are used to disclose reportable information associated with members defined in one or many axes of the table.
+ Details
No definition available.
|X
- Definition
+ References
Percentage of average annual depreciation rates for property plant and equipment.
+ Details
No definition available.
|X
- Definition
+ References
Useful lives or depreciation rates of property plant and equipment.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details